About Angela Cannas

Angela Cannas is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Parasitology and Epidemiology, having authored 35 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(20 papers), Mycobacterium research and diagnosis (13 papers) and Toxoplasma gondii Research Studies (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Parasitology (319 citations), Infectious Diseases (310 citations) and Epidemiology (404 citations). Angela Cannas has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Switzerland and United States. Frequent co-authors include Andrew Hemphill, Arunasalam Naguleswaran, Bruno Gottstein, Samuil R. Umansky, Licia Tomei, Enrico Girardi, Natalya Ossina, Paul Fitzpatrick, James R. Gilbert and Michael Kiefer.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, PLoS ONE and Nature Cell Biology.
